What they do
A General Internist provides primary medical care for adult patients, including diagnosis, treatment and preventative care. Treats illnesses and helps patients to manage complex or chronic diseases. Works in a private practice, hospital or long term care setting.

Job Description
Lincoln Hospital, a 25-bed critical access hospital and proud member of MaineHealth, is seeking a full-time Geriatrician to join our experienced and collaborative team. Lincoln Hospital operates nursing homes on two of its campuses in Damariscotta and Boothbay Harbor. This position will primarily be based at our Damariscotta campus, providing care to long-term care residents. There is also flexibility to expand the practice outside of the nursing home, based on candidate interest, including opportunities for inpatient care at other MaineHealth facilities or primary care within other Lincoln Hospital outpatient clinics. This role will be part of the Division of Geriatrics at MaineHealth, a system-wide team that delivers comprehensive geriatric services across the state. These services include inpatient and outpatient care, community resources, and access to healthcare practitioners specifically trained in Geriatrics. While the core Geriatrics team is based in Portland, this position will play a key role in expanding services throughout Maine's MidCoast region. Desired Qualifications & Experience Education/Training:
- Completion of an ACGME-accredited residency program in Internal Medicine, Family Medicine, or equivalent.
- Fellowship training in Geriatrics preferred.
Licenses/Certifications:
- Eligible for licensure in the State of Maine.
- Board-certified or board-eligible in Family Medicine, Internal Medicine, Geriatrics or similar.
- Ability to obtain and maintain credentialing and privileges at designated hospital locations.
